• MEMO TO: MAYOR AND CITY COUN IL <br /> Ilb°1 <br /> FROM: CLERK-ADMINISTRATOR 7:47 <br /> DATE: MARCH 13, 1990 <br /> SUBJECT: 1990 SPRING CLEAN UP DAY <br /> I have contacted our service providers for Spring Clean-Up Day <br /> and secured the following companies at the costs listed: <br /> 1. Maust Fiberfuels will again handle the disposal of <br /> tires at the cost of $1.00 for auto and small truck and <br /> $5.00 for a large truck; the same as last year. <br /> This will be a direct pass-thru to all users of the <br /> Clean-Up Day disposing of tires. <br /> 2 . Appliance disposal will be handled by Appliance <br /> Recycling Centers at a cost of $6.00 per appliance; <br /> $1.00 less than last fall. This will also be a direct <br /> pass-thru to all users. <br /> 3. Goodwill Industries is currently determining whether or <br /> • not they will be able to provide us with a semi trailer <br /> on that day due to the fact that they have committed <br /> over 20 of their trailers for other clean-up days <br /> throughout the Metropolitan Area on the same day as <br /> ours. If a trailer is available, Goodwill will not be <br /> able to provide an attendant and staff will attempt to <br /> secure volunteers from the community. <br /> 4. Refuse disposal will again be provided by Container <br /> Service Incorporated with the cost being based upon <br /> volume due to rates now being charged by landfills in <br /> the Metropolitan area. We will be paying a base fee of <br /> $120 per 30 yard container and a volume fee of $53.00 <br /> per ton for disposal costs with the average container <br /> holding 3 tons based upon past experience. This would <br /> result in a cost of $279 per load vs. the $250 per load <br /> price in 1989 . <br /> 5. Brush disposal will again be handled by Aspen Tree <br /> Service at the rate of $250 per load; the same as last <br /> year. <br /> Based upon the increased fees for disposal of refuse and the <br /> experience we have had over the last few years with different <br /> sizes of loads being brought to the garage for Clean-Up Day, I <br /> 411 would recommend the following rate schedule. <br />
